novel-writing is a powerful AI agent skill that extends your assistant with new capabilities. AI long-form web article creation skills package. It is used to solve the core pain points in the creation of full-length online novels: loss of context, inconsistent writing styles, setting conflicts, out-of-control rhythm, multi-line confusion, unstable quality, and inability to internalize reader feedback. Trigger scenarios include: starting a new book, planning an outline, writing chapters, managing foreshadowing, detecting conflicts, analyzing reader feedback, and controlling batch creation quality.
